Debido al elevado Coeficiente de Expansión Térmica Lineal (CLTE) del policarbonato, 65~70 x 10-6 m/k, la tasa de expansión debida a los cambios térmicos debe tenerse en cuenta a la hora de calcular el tamaño necesario, y debe dejarse espacio suficiente para estos cambios durante la instalación.
Una lámina de policarbonato de 3 metros de largo, por ejemplo, se dilatará aproximadamente 2,1 mm por cada aumento de temperatura de 10 °C. Una plancha de 5 metros de largo sujeta en un extremo por estar pegada a una pared de ladrillos puede tener un movimiento en su extremo libre de más de 10 mm en el transcurso de un día con un aumento de temperatura de 30 °C.
Before the introduction of fasteners dedicated to fixing thermoplastics, and when metal fixing hex washer screws were still used, fixing any plastic sheets required at least 2 steps. First, pre-drilling an expansion hole that is approx. 2 times the diameter of the screw using a standard drill bit, which is followed by screwing down the metal roofing screw.
More often than not, builders will skip the first step and drill through the metal roofing screw directly, which is like a ticking time bomb waiting to explode, because sooner or later, the sheets are bound to deform, craze, crack, and break all the way through.
VULCAN Plastics, in collaboration with BDN Fasteners, have come up with PolyFast, a polycarbonate screw with a hassle free, fail safe design, and literally the easiest to use skylight fixing fastener on the market.
PolyFast Crest Fixing Fasteners can be used on all kinds of plastic glazing material and especially effective when used as polycarbonate roofing screws, with its length designed to accommodate the crest height of VULCAN ROMA and GRECA profiles.
The attached round cutting saw creates a much-required 10mm diameter thermal expansion hole on plastic roofing materials which then securely fastens onto the purlin underneath in one-go.
A large domed BAZ washer completes the package, covering the expansion hole while providing superior strength against high winds.
